Home
last modified time | relevance | path

Searched refs:to_kill (Results 1 – 17 of 17) sorted by relevance

/third_party/skia/third_party/externals/swiftshader/third_party/SPIRV-Tools/source/opt/
Dstrip_debug_info_pass.cpp31 std::vector<Instruction*> to_kill; in Process() local
62 if (no_nonsemantic_use) to_kill.push_back(&inst); in Process()
68 to_kill.push_back(&inst); in Process()
73 for (auto& dbg : context()->debugs1()) to_kill.push_back(&dbg); in Process()
76 for (auto& dbg : context()->debugs2()) to_kill.push_back(&dbg); in Process()
77 for (auto& dbg : context()->debugs3()) to_kill.push_back(&dbg); in Process()
78 for (auto& dbg : context()->ext_inst_debuginfo()) to_kill.push_back(&dbg); in Process()
83 std::sort(to_kill.begin(), to_kill.end(), in Process()
90 bool modified = !to_kill.empty(); in Process()
92 for (auto* inst : to_kill) context()->KillInst(inst); in Process()
Deliminate_dead_functions_util.cpp26 std::unordered_set<Instruction*> to_kill; in EliminateFunction() local
30 &to_kill](Instruction* inst) { in EliminateFunction()
38 if (to_kill.find(inst) != to_kill.end()) return; in EliminateFunction()
50 } else if (to_kill.find(inst) == to_kill.end()) { in EliminateFunction()
51 context->CollectNonSemanticTree(inst, &to_kill); in EliminateFunction()
57 for (auto* dead : to_kill) { in EliminateFunction()
Dif_conversion.cpp32 std::vector<Instruction*> to_kill; in Process() local
50 block.ForEachPhiInst([this, &builder, &modified, &common, &to_kill, in Process()
135 to_kill.push_back(phi); in Process()
143 for (auto inst : to_kill) { in Process()
Dir_context.cpp221 Instruction* inst, std::unordered_set<Instruction*>* to_kill) { in CollectNonSemanticTree() argument
233 i, [&work_list, to_kill, &seen](Instruction* user) { in CollectNonSemanticTree()
236 to_kill->insert(user); in CollectNonSemanticTree()
Dir_context.h411 std::unordered_set<Instruction*>* to_kill);
/third_party/skia/third_party/externals/spirv-tools/source/opt/
Dstrip_debug_info_pass.cpp31 std::vector<Instruction*> to_kill; in Process() local
62 if (no_nonsemantic_use) to_kill.push_back(&inst); in Process()
68 to_kill.push_back(&inst); in Process()
73 for (auto& dbg : context()->debugs1()) to_kill.push_back(&dbg); in Process()
76 for (auto& dbg : context()->debugs2()) to_kill.push_back(&dbg); in Process()
77 for (auto& dbg : context()->debugs3()) to_kill.push_back(&dbg); in Process()
78 for (auto& dbg : context()->ext_inst_debuginfo()) to_kill.push_back(&dbg); in Process()
83 std::sort(to_kill.begin(), to_kill.end(), in Process()
90 bool modified = !to_kill.empty(); in Process()
92 for (auto* inst : to_kill) context()->KillInst(inst); in Process()
Deliminate_dead_functions_util.cpp26 std::unordered_set<Instruction*> to_kill; in EliminateFunction() local
30 &to_kill](Instruction* inst) { in EliminateFunction()
38 if (to_kill.find(inst) != to_kill.end()) return; in EliminateFunction()
50 } else if (to_kill.find(inst) == to_kill.end()) { in EliminateFunction()
51 context->CollectNonSemanticTree(inst, &to_kill); in EliminateFunction()
57 for (auto* dead : to_kill) { in EliminateFunction()
Dif_conversion.cpp32 std::vector<Instruction*> to_kill; in Process() local
50 block.ForEachPhiInst([this, &builder, &modified, &common, &to_kill, in Process()
135 to_kill.push_back(phi); in Process()
143 for (auto inst : to_kill) { in Process()
Dir_context.cpp221 Instruction* inst, std::unordered_set<Instruction*>* to_kill) { in CollectNonSemanticTree() argument
233 i, [&work_list, to_kill, &seen](Instruction* user) { in CollectNonSemanticTree()
236 to_kill->insert(user); in CollectNonSemanticTree()
Dir_context.h411 std::unordered_set<Instruction*>* to_kill);
/third_party/spirv-tools/source/opt/
Dstrip_debug_info_pass.cpp31 std::vector<Instruction*> to_kill; in Process() local
63 if (no_nonsemantic_use) to_kill.push_back(&inst); in Process()
69 to_kill.push_back(&inst); in Process()
74 for (auto& dbg : context()->debugs1()) to_kill.push_back(&dbg); in Process()
77 for (auto& dbg : context()->debugs2()) to_kill.push_back(&dbg); in Process()
78 for (auto& dbg : context()->debugs3()) to_kill.push_back(&dbg); in Process()
79 for (auto& dbg : context()->ext_inst_debuginfo()) to_kill.push_back(&dbg); in Process()
84 std::sort(to_kill.begin(), to_kill.end(), in Process()
91 bool modified = !to_kill.empty(); in Process()
93 for (auto* inst : to_kill) context()->KillInst(inst); in Process()
Deliminate_dead_functions_util.cpp26 std::unordered_set<Instruction*> to_kill; in EliminateFunction() local
30 &to_kill](Instruction* inst) { in EliminateFunction()
38 if (to_kill.find(inst) != to_kill.end()) return; in EliminateFunction()
50 } else if (to_kill.find(inst) == to_kill.end()) { in EliminateFunction()
51 context->CollectNonSemanticTree(inst, &to_kill); in EliminateFunction()
57 for (auto* dead : to_kill) { in EliminateFunction()
Dif_conversion.cpp32 std::vector<Instruction*> to_kill; in Process() local
50 block.ForEachPhiInst([this, &builder, &modified, &common, &to_kill, in Process()
135 to_kill.push_back(phi); in Process()
143 for (auto inst : to_kill) { in Process()
Dir_context.cpp223 Instruction* inst, std::unordered_set<Instruction*>* to_kill) { in CollectNonSemanticTree() argument
235 i, [&work_list, to_kill, &seen](Instruction* user) { in CollectNonSemanticTree()
238 to_kill->insert(user); in CollectNonSemanticTree()
Dir_context.h412 std::unordered_set<Instruction*>* to_kill);
/third_party/libwebsockets/include/libwebsockets/
Dlws-timeout-timer.h117 #define lws_wsi_close(w, to_kill) lws_set_timeout(w, 1, to_kill) argument
/third_party/libbpf/.github/actions/build-selftests/
Dvmlinux.h42160 struct to_kill { struct
42168 struct to_kill tk; argument